Anomali was founded in 2013 by Martin Gedalin. The company has not publicly endorsed plans to participate in an IPO, though the company expanded its leadership team in 2021 and 2022, citing the executives' IPO track records as a factor in the appointments.
Anomali is an AI-powered cybersecurity firm. The company reports having customers "around the world in nearly every major industry vertical." Anomali has been recognized by a number of industry-wide award bodies, including the 2022 Cybersecurity Excellence Awards and the Global INFOSEC Awards 2022. Anomali has raised more than $95 million in venture capital funding from investors including GV, Paladin Capital Group, In-Q-Tel, Institutional Venture Partners, and General Catalyst. The company did not disclose valuation figures following a $40 million round of Series D funding in 2018.
